QbanCastillo Posted August 14, 2020 Share Posted August 14, 2020 7 hours ago, CoastieMike said: do you by chance know how much data you use a month in the household? I live in Las Vegas, so we have Cox over here. I have a 1TB plan, and I can say that with 4 people in our house we have used an average of 908GB for the past 3 months. I watch A LOT of YouTube videos, and my mother and grandmother watch a lot of Netflix. I think you should be good for 2 people with 1TB. 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

hovertical Posted September 3, 2020 Share Posted September 3, 2020 we have a 1TB plan as well with just my wife and myself in the house and have never come close to hitting the 1TB cap. We considered cutting the cord but with the things we do watch, it would not have been cost effective so we just pared back and dropped the premium movie channels and pay $140 a month for 1gbps speeds and most cable channels outside of the premium movie ones. Word of advice for people looking at cutting the cord - take a gander at your bill and see if you're being hit with modem lease fees and DVR fees - we save a shit ton a month because we own that equipment so we don't have to lease it. Literally around $50 a month saved.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
